U2414H, Dual, PSM (Power Saving Mode) issue on #1 monitor

Hello Dell people.

I have an issue with one of my Dell U2414H monitor. My computer is running Win7 (pro x64) and is set to turn off the display in 15 minutes. When that 15 minutes runs out, my screens go to power saving mode. But every 5-10 seconds, this monitor wakes up to show "Entering Power Save Mode" and then goes blank again. I found a video showing that behavior (wanted to video myself, but no need, because this is the exactly the same case) -> 

Second monitor, which is also U2414H monitor, doesn't have such an issue.

Now after multiple turning off and on, changing DP-DP and mDP-DP cabel in multiple combination, I've found the way for my left monitor to not go into Power save mode over and over again.

Final solution is to have my left monitor in 4 (DP-DP connection), my right in 2 (DP-DP connection) and the TV in 1 (HDMI-HDMI). I guess it has something to do with combination of cables and ports. Will leave it this way. Have no idea why the input 3 hates my left monitor :(

* Turn the computer and both U2414H off
* Disconnect both U2414H from the computer
* Disconnect all video cables from both U2414H
* Test each U2414H, by itself, on the GTX 970 DP out port using ONE U2414H DP to mDP cable
GTX 970 DP out port --> U2414H DP to mDP cable --> U2414H mDP in port
* Turn the computer on, then the U2414H. Test for PSM (power save mode) issue
* Turn all off and now test the #2 U2414H by itself.

* Repeat the same testing for both U2414H using the OTHER shipped DP to mDP cable
